Sufy Epic is seeking a passionate Social Media Manager to help the project take off.
The role focuses on generating authentic user-generated content and managing paid ads to drive book sales and awareness, mainly on Tik Tok and Instagram.
Join a small team working on a fantasy universe blending Indian mythology with epic storytelling.
